About Your Trip

These trips are offshore near Charleston, South Carolina. You will have an experience, Captain and 1st Mate on board a 46 foot post Sportfisher. We provide all the gear licenses permit, etc. all you have to do is real in the fish.. customer is responsible for their own food and drink during the trip as well as sunscreen and proper attire.

When we get back to the dock, we will clean and bag your fish
for you to take home.

We will troll for the various pelagic type of fish to include mahi-mahi, wahoo, tuna, Marlyn and sailfish. We can bottom fish for various types of snapper grouper, and whatever else bites.!

In the event of inclement weather, our guides will check the conditions and make the final call on whether its safe to go on the trip. If they decide the trip needs to be postponed, we'll work closely with you to reschedule or provide a credit for the full deposit, which can be applied to any of our trips in the US and beyond.
Each trip's price is determined by the guide and reflects all associated costs. A significant factor in pricing is often the type of boat and the corresponding fuel expenses. Additional costs may include leases, marina or slip fees, and the expenses involved in providing and maintaining the necessary gear for your trip.
